Orioles Decline 2008 Option On Benson

BALTIMORE (AP) ―

The Baltimore Orioles cut ties with Kris Benson Thursday, declining their $7.5 million option on the right-hander.
  
Benson, who missed the 2007 season with a torn labrum, filed for free agency later in the day and will receive a $500,000 buyout.

He made 30 starts for the Orioles in 2006, going 11-12 with a 4.82 ERA, after being acquired from the New York Mets in a trade.
  
In seven major league seasons for the Pirates, Mets and Orioles, Benson is 68-73 with a 4.34 ERA.
